The IFA Administrator Role:
Working alongside experienced Financial Advisers and Paraplanners, the IFA Administrator will play a key role in ensuring the smooth and efficient delivery of the financial planning process.
IFA Administrator Responsibilities:
- Providing comprehensive administrative support to Financial Advisers and Paraplanners
- Preparing and processing client documentation, applications, and new business
- Managing client correspondence and maintaining accurate records
- Liaising with providers, platforms and third parties to obtain information and progress cases
- Processing new business and monitoring applications through to completion
- Arranging client meetings and maintaining adviser diaries where required
- Preparing meeting packs, valuations, and supporting documentation
- Updating and maintaining client records and ensuring systems remain accurate and compliant
- Assisting with ongoing client servicing and review processes
- Following up outstanding requirements and ensuring cases progress within agreed timescales
- Supporting the wider financial planning team with day-to-day administrative requirements
